The cheapest way to get from Houston to Clayton is to drive which costs $160 - $240 and takes 14h 51m.
The fastest way to get from Houston to Clayton is to fly and drive which takes 6h 6m and costs $140 - $700.
The distance between Houston and Clayton is 950 miles. The road distance is 903.8 miles.
The best way to get from Houston to Clayton without a car is to bus and taxi which takes 19h 45m and costs $280 - $450.
It takes approximately 6h 6m to get from Houston to Clayton, including transfers.
Clayton is 1h ahead of Houston. It is currently 6:25 AM in Houston and 7:25 AM in Clayton.
Yes, the driving distance between Houston to Clayton is 904 miles. It takes approximately 14h 51m to drive from Houston to Clayton.
